    ProAudio Electronics in Tampa deserves every one of their high ratings -- and then some…read more We brought in my wife's Roland digital piano for warranty service, after she was having ongoing trouble changing voices and settings. Roland's own user manual was confusing at best, and even Roland Support wasn't able to help her resolve the issue. The tech who initially examined the piano couldn't find anything physically wrong with it (which many shops would have used as an excuse to send us on our way). But instead of brushing us off, the staff -- especially Santiago at the front desk and Mike (the owner, though you'd never know it by his down-to-earth attitude) -- went above and beyond to make sure my wife fully understood what was going on. Mike spent a lot of time personally walking her through the controls and discovered that the problem was a poorly explained instruction in Roland's manual regarding the C1 key used for voice changes. Once the correct key was identified and explained clearly, everything worked perfectly. The important thing is this: ProAudio was absolutely determined not to send Cindy home until she was completely satisfied and comfortable using her piano -- even though there was technically "nothing wrong" with it to repair. Many shops would have simply said, "We can't find a problem -- call Roland." ProAudio didn't do that. They made it their problem, and they solved it. Outstanding service, knowledgeable staff, and a level of personal attention that's becoming rare these days. Highly recommended.
